An engineering-first perspective on material chemistry, load distribution, and structural design optimization.
Our production cycle initiates with certified raw material grading. We source premium-grade structural steel (predominantly Q235B, conforming to GB/T 700-2006). This provides optimal yield strength (235 MPa) and tensile properties necessary for load ratings reaching up to 500kg per shelf, depending on the chosen configuration. The board material utilizes precision-sealed, eco-friendly MDF or particle boards configured with edge sealing to mitigate moisture absorption and off-gassing.
Using structural engineering suites (including SolidWorks and AutoCAD), our 80-engineer R&D team drafts dynamic stress-distribution profiles. Finite Element Analysis (FEA) is executed to ensure shelving columns do not buckle under structural overload. This custom engineering step optimizes the placement of beam connectors and floor-anchoring columns for seismic-prone installations.
To withstand diverse microclimates—ranging from high-humidity coastal zones to climate-controlled cleanrooms—all steel elements undergo multi-stage chemical pretreatment, phosphating, and automatic electrostatic powder coating. Coating thickness is maintained at a rigorous 60–80 microns, passing rigorous 500-hour salt spray corrosion testing in our dedicated labs.
For modern conference rooms, structural shelving must act as a tech conduit. Custom ODM designs include hidden internal wire raceways, perforated cable management panels, and cooling ventilation slots designed to house active hardware, such as network switch units and AV distribution nodes, without overheating.

Our QA processes guarantee every product line stands up to strict international standards.
Our facility complies with ISO 14001 environmental policies and TUV structural safety requirements. We focus on green manufacturing processes, minimal waste, and certified welding profiles across our lines.
We perform automated CMM dimensional checks to ensure tolerances stay within ±0.05mm. This consistency avoids installation delays and alignment issues during setup in global corporate boardrooms.
With 62 dedicated QA specialists, we run routine load deflection, joint fatigue, and shear tests. This guarantees our storage and display systems meet or exceed their rated capacities over years of service.
